First off, let's talk about what anti-shock boots are all about. Anti-shock boots are designed to absorb and disperse the impact of sudden shocks, like when you're walking on hard surfaces, running, or working in an environment where you might be exposed to heavy objects dropping. They're often used in industries such as construction, manufacturing, and sports. The key feature of anti-shock boots is their sole technology. These soles are usually made of special materials that can compress and expand quickly, reducing the force that gets transferred to your feet and legs.

On the other hand, orthopedic shoes are mainly focused on providing support and correcting foot problems. They're often prescribed by doctors for people with conditions like flat feet, plantar fasciitis, or back pain. Orthopedic shoes have features like arch support, heel cups, and custom orthotics to help align the feet properly and reduce stress on the joints.

Comfort

When it comes to comfort, both anti-shock boots and orthopedic shoes have their own advantages. Anti-shock boots are great for people who are on their feet all day, especially in high-impact situations. The shock-absorbing soles can make a huge difference in how tired your feet feel at the end of the day. For example, if you're a construction worker who spends hours walking on concrete, anti-shock boots can help reduce the fatigue and pain caused by the constant impact.

Orthopedic shoes are also very comfortable, but in a different way. They're designed to fit your feet perfectly and provide support where you need it most. If you have a foot condition, wearing orthopedic shoes can relieve pain and make walking more comfortable. However, some people might find orthopedic shoes a bit stiff or bulky at first, especially if they're not used to wearing shoes with so much support.

Support

Support is another important factor to consider. Anti-shock boots typically provide good support for the feet and ankles, especially during high-impact activities. The soles are designed to keep your feet stable and prevent excessive movement. This can be really helpful in preventing injuries, like sprains or strains.

Orthopedic shoes, on the other hand, offer more targeted support. They're customized to address specific foot problems, so they can provide better support for the arches, heels, and other areas of the feet. If you have a pre-existing foot condition or a problem with your gait, orthopedic shoes might be a better choice for you.

Durability

Durability is a big deal, especially if you're using your shoes or boots for work or sports. Anti-shock boots are usually built to last. They're made with tough materials that can withstand the rigors of daily use. For example, many anti-shock boots have reinforced toes and outsoles that are resistant to wear and tear.

Orthopedic shoes can also be quite durable, but it depends on the quality of the materials and the construction. Some orthopedic shoes are made with high-quality leather or synthetic materials that can last for a long time. However, because they're often designed for specific foot conditions, they might not be as rugged as anti-shock boots.

Cost

Cost is always a consideration when buying shoes or boots. Anti-shock boots can range in price depending on the brand, features, and quality. Generally, you can expect to pay a bit more for high-quality anti-shock boots, but they're often worth the investment, especially if you're using them for work or sports.

Orthopedic shoes can also be expensive, especially if they're custom-made or come with special orthotics. However, some insurance plans might cover the cost of orthopedic shoes if they're prescribed by a doctor.

Which One Should You Choose?

So, which one is better - anti-shock boots or orthopedic shoes? Well, it really depends on your needs. If you're looking for shoes that can handle high-impact activities and provide good shock absorption, anti-shock boots are a great choice. They're perfect for people who work in industries like construction, manufacturing, or sports.

If you have a foot condition or need extra support for your feet, orthopedic shoes might be the way to go. They're designed to address specific foot problems and can provide targeted support and relief.

In some cases, you might even need both. For example, if you have a foot condition but also need to wear shoes for high-impact activities, you could wear orthopedic shoes for everyday use and anti-shock boots when you're working or playing sports.
